Abu l-Fadl Hasdai ibn Yusuf ibn Hasdai
Abu l-Fadl Hasdai ibn Yusuf ibn Hasdai (1050–1093) was a writer and poet.
Also recorded as Abu l-Fadl ibn Hasdai; Abu al-Fadl Hasdai; Abu al-Fadl ibn Hasdai.
Overview
Born at Zaragoza in 1050, died at Cairo in 1093.
In detail
the recorded working language is Spanish.
Positions recorded include vizier.
